About The Position

The Fairmont Scottsdale Princess is looking for Event Technicians to help bring our resort’s world-renowned holiday experiences to life. This position is rooted in holiday lighting and décor installation but has grown to include select entertainment technology support. We’re looking for creative, detail-oriented individuals who take pride in technical excellence, holiday spirit, and guest satisfaction. Whether you're wrapping a 60-foot tree in lights, installing dynamic high-end dynamic lighting fixtures to create immersive experiences, or helping with holiday audio, every day brings a new opportunity to help create unforgettable moments.

Requirements

  • Previous experience in Christmas light installation or related field.
  • Comfortable working at heights.
  • Strong troubleshooting skills with basic electrical systems.
  • Ability to lift up to 100lbs and perform physically demanding tasks.
  • Excellent communication and customer service skills.
  • Patience and attention to detail.
  • Willingness to work outdoors in varying weather conditions.

Nice To Haves

  • Knowledge of DMX, lighting consoles, or live event production workflows.
  • Familiarity with lighting and sound in an entertainment or theatrical setting.
  • A background in technical theater, event production, theme parks, or live shows.
  • Knowledge of holiday lighting controllers and protocols such as but not limited to LOR, XLights, and WS2811.

Responsibilities

  • Holiday Lighting & Décor Installation (Primary Focus)
  • Install, maintain, and remove large-scale seasonal lighting displays and themed décor across resort grounds, rooftops, and trees.
  • Handle electrical wiring, power distribution, and weatherproofing of holiday installations.
  • Work from ladders, lifts, and rooftops to safely execute high-quality lighting layouts and visual displays.
  • Support Live Entertainment & Event Production (Secondary)
  • Assist with setup and teardown of lighting and audio elements for pre-programmed nighttime shows and activations.
  • Install and troubleshoot moving lights, DMX-controlled fixtures, and basic sound equipment.
  • Collaborate with third party A/V teams to ensure seamless integration of décor and entertainment elements.
  • Maintenance & Safety
  • Troubleshoot lighting failures or circuit issues, replacing lamps or cables as needed.
  • Operate hand and power tools, lifts, and specialty equipment safely and efficiently.
  • Follow all resort, OSHA, and event safety procedures—especially when working at heights or with power.
